WebExchange, Trade, and Cultural Encounter in North America. The history of cross-cultural contact in North America from the late sixteenth through nineteenth centuries, examining cultures, economies, trading institutions and views of New and Old World people. Course Hours: 3 units; (3S-0) Prerequisite (s): History 300.
